The rise of printing was greatly affected by Mahayana Buddhism. As outlined by Mahayana beliefs, spiritual texts maintain intrinsic worth for carrying the Buddha's word, and work as talismanic objects that contains sacred electrical power able to warding off evil spirits. By copying and preserving these texts, Buddhists could accrue personalized benefit. As a consequence the thought of printing and its strengths in replicating texts promptly turned evident to Buddhists. Through the 7th century CE, they have been making use of woodblocks to make apotropaic documents. These Buddhist texts were printed specifically as ritual goods, and were not extensively circulated or designed for general public usage. Rather they were being buried in consecrated floor. The earliest extant example of this type of printed make any difference is a fraction of a dhāraṇī (Buddhist spell) miniature scroll created in Sanskrit unearthed inside of a tomb in Xi'an.

Screenprinting has its origins in straightforward stencilling, most notably on the Japanese type (katazome) consumer who cut banana leaves and inserted ink from the design and style holes on textiles, largely for outfits. This was taken up in France.
A Facit E560 dot matrix printer Every dot is made by a tiny metallic rod, also referred to as a "wire" or "pin", which can be driven ahead by the power of a small electromagnet or solenoid, either instantly or by little levers (pawls). Struggling with the ribbon plus the paper is a small manual plate (frequently product of a synthetic jewel for example sapphire or ruby[119]) pierced with holes to serve as guides for the pins.

Woodblock printing also modified the shape and structure of books. Scrolls were step by step changed by concertina binding (經摺裝) with the Tang period of time onward. The edge was that it had been now feasible to flip to a reference without having unfolding the whole doc.
